bonsoir,
comment on transpose les données des lignes d'un tableau en colonnes sur MYSQL. J'ai cherché dans des forums, mais j'ai trouvé pour access et sql server.
merci
bonsoir,
comment on transpose les données des lignes d'un tableau en colonnes sur MYSQL. J'ai cherché dans des forums, mais j'ai trouvé pour access et sql server.
merci
Je crains que ce que tu cherches à faire ne soit de la cosmétique qui n'est pas le boulot du SGBD mais celui du logiciel qui interroge la BDD et présente les résultats à l'utilisateur final.
Philippe Leménager. Ingénieur d'étude à l'École Nationale Supérieure de Formation de l'Enseignement Agricole, en retraite... mais toujours Autoentrepreneur à l'occasion.
Mon ancien blog sur la conception des BDD, le langage SQL, le PHP... et mon nouveau blog sur les mêmes sujets.
« Ce que l'on conçoit bien s'énonce clairement, et les mots pour le dire arrivent aisément ». (Nicolas Boileau)
À la maison comme au bureau, j'utilise la suite Linux Mageïa !
salut,
cinephil a raison tu confonds, comme beaucoup, une table de sgbd avec une matrice mathématique...
un sgbd c'est fait pour stocker des données et les rassembler et / ou trier selon des critères...
mais tu es pas le premier à le demander et j'avais donné la solution ici ou dans mysql procédural, regarde bien...
perso il est clair que je ferais la transposition dans un tableau dans le langage du serveur choisi (php, java, etc...)... c'est plus facile et performant de faire une copie d'un tableau en permutant les indices...
Voilà un lien qui peut aider!!!
http://datacharmer.org/downloads/piv...es_mysql_5.pdf
http://en.wikibooks.org/wiki/MySQL/Pivot_table
Partager